Overview

Fire engineers specialise in the application of science and engineering principles to protect people and their environment from destructive fire.

The Master of Engineering in Fire Engineering is open to graduates from relevant branches of engineering, and covers all aspects of fire safety in buildings and other structures, human safety, and risk assessment. 

Some courses are offered in blocks and online learning software allows for flexible programmes of study. Students also complete a thesis or project.
